What is the Habitat Data Collection Form?
The Habitat Data Collection Form is a vital tool used in botanical research and habitat surveys. It provides defined fields for critical site data, allowing researchers to gather detailed information about plant habitats efficiently. Tailored for field use, this form includes specific fillable fields designed for easy data entry on-site.
Researchers can leverage this form to efficiently document essential ecological parameters, ensuring their data collection is both effective and complete. Incorporating functionality like a botanical data collection sheet enhances the form's utility in various studies.

Key Features of the Habitat Data Collection Form
This form boasts several components that enhance its functionality. Key sections include site data, plant species identification, collection details, and photographic data, each designed for comprehensive data documentation.
-
Fillable fields and checkboxes simplify data entry.
-
Sections for notes and sketches capture additional contextual information.
-
Organized layout aids in quick reference during fieldwork.
